A core-sheath structure adsorption fiber and its preparation method

This invention provides a method for preparing a core-sheath structured adsorbent fiber, comprising the following steps: S1. Preparation of the sheath spinning solution: Ethyl cellulose porous microspheres are added to polyester chips and melted and mixed uniformly to obtain the sheath spinning solution; S2. Preparation of the core spinning solution: Porous tea powder loaded with mussel protein is added to a cellulose solution to obtain the core spinning solution; S3. Preparation of the core-sheath structured adsorbent fiber: The sheath spinning solution and the core spinning solution are respectively added to the two feeding ports of a co-rotating twin-screw extruder. The two solutions are extruded through the co-rotating twin-screw extruder, then metered by a metering pump and fed into a spinning assembly for wet spinning through a spinneret, resulting in a composite fiber with cellulose as the core and polyester as the sheath. This invention utilizes a core-sheath structure, where the sheath contains a porous structure, and the core is composed of porous tea powder, mussel protein, and cellulose. The sheath provides adsorption channels, and the core is rich in functional groups such as phenolic hydroxyl groups, which can adsorb odors and provide moisture absorption and wicking properties.
